Description: This position is responsible for managing, supervising, and coordinating all activities related to food safety and sanitation programs within the facility. The Sanitation Supervisor ensures effective execution of plant cleaning and sanitation operations, while maintaining strict comp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s), food safety standards, and company sanitation policies and procedures.
The role requires a strong commitment to workplace safety, with an expectation to consistently adhere to and promote safety work rules. The Sanitation Supervisor plays a key role in reinforcing Safety as a Core Value throughout the organization. This position also ensures that all food safety and quality policies, procedures, and activities are uniformly followed and enforced, with the goal of minimizing product and process variability and maintaining the highest standards of hygiene and compliance.
Duties and Responsibilities:
Oversee sanitation of the entire plant, including both interior and exterior areas
Develop, monitor, and update all plant sanitation procedures and practices as needed
Supervise sanitation and janitorial staff, including daily activities and performance management
Train employees on proper methods for testing chemical concentrations and maintaining test kits
Organize the sanitation crew efficiently to maximize resources; schedule work assignments and participate in hiring, termination, and performance evaluations
Monitor and assist sanitation employees during equipment cleaning to ensure proper sanitation practices and chemical safety
Track and report on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), including the Master Sanitation Program, pre-operational inspections, and visual observations
Communicate sanitation-related issues or potential concerns to management promptly
Monitor Clean-Out-of-Place (COP) systems and act as liaison with ChemStation to ensure proper system function and accuracy
Assist in preparation for third-party audits and participate in the auditing process
Lead the cross-functional sanitation team to drive continuous improvement
Conduct safety and educational training sessions for sanitation staff
Manage inventory and ordering of sanitation supplies
Take personal responsibility for maintaining a safe and healthy workplace; adhere to all safety policies and procedures
Follow quality work practices, GMPs, and sanitary conditions to ensure product quality; report any conditions that may impact food safety or quality
Ensure compliance with all regulatory requirements at all times
Actively lead and/or participate in the plant safety team
Perform other duties as assigned by management
